Transaction 4913943ecd5fc57592d6f2a020a4f9f707f0674029af38021bb7568fe91d2aca
1 Input
1 Output
-
4913943ecd5fc57592d6f2a020a4f9f707f0674029af38021bb7568fe91d2aca:0
- value
- 4165236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cf990f087b89752eeff70d9e046669a3147de75 OP_EQUAL
- address
- 37FRSDRmvtCiFC6mv4v4y1yhLH89bTU3fV